This was also discussed in another thread, but the most recent Road & Track issue just tested the 330 6 speed 0-60mph at 6.2 seconds and Car & Driver got a 5.6 in its April article. If we split the difference that's a respectable 5.9. Obviously 0-60 times are not the end all otherwise 3 series cars would never have sold well in the past or as well as E90's are selling now. As has been said many times there's certain other elements that make the 3 series the ultimate sports sedan/coupe.
R&T: E90 330i - 6-speed manual 0-60: 6.2 seconds 1/4 mile: 14.9 @ 94.1 mph 0-100: 16.9 seconds Skidpad: 0.83g Slalom: 66.6 mph 80-0 braking: 209 ft Car & Driver on the other hand got a 5.6 0-60 back in April Zero to 30 mph: 1.9 40 mph: 3.0 50 mph: 4.4 60 mph: 5.6 70 mph: 7.7 80 mph: 9.7 90 mph: 11.8 100 mph: 15.3 110 mph: 18.8 120 mph: 22.9 130 mph: 29.1 Street start, 5-60 mph: 6.0 Top-gear acceleration, 30-50 mph: 9.5 50-70 mph: 8.6 Standing 1/4-mile: 14.3 sec @ 98 mph Top speed (governor limited): 155 mph http://www.caranddriver.com/article....&page_number=3 |
